Israeli occupation forces launched Thursday, 13 October 2022, a campaign of raids across the occupied West Bank and Jerusalem, detaining at least 20 Palestinians after breaking into their homes.
In the occupied Jerusalem, IOF invaded the Qalandia camp and detained 4 Palestinians young men identified as Faris Abu Sharekh, Abdullah Abdul Rahman, Munir Yaqoub, and Mahmoud Naim Hamad.
Israeli troops abducted Muhammad Nizar Mazaru, Mustafa Hassan Mustafa, Yazan Abu Asab, Waseem Dari, Ahmed Haitham Mahmoud, Loay Ashraf Mahmoud, Mansour Nasser, Muhammad Daoud Nasser, Muhammad Daoud Abi, Muhammad Alaa Mahmoud, Shadi Awad, and Muhammad Mamoun Muhaisen from the occuiped Jerusalems’s neighborhoods.
In Jenin, Israeli occupation forces arrested Muhammad Ibrahim Abed from the town of Kafr Dan after raiding his home.
In Bethlehem, the young Palestinian man Musab al-Saifi reported that Israeli occupation kidnaped him along with Mahmoud Abu Ayyash during a military incursion into the Dheisheh refugee camp.
In the south of the West Bank, IOF invaded Hebron city and arrested Ahmed Siuri and Mahmoud Abbas Al-Asafra from Beit Kahil at an Israeli military checkpoint on Al-Shuhada Street.
Palestinian towns and villages in the occuiped West Bank and Jerusalem have seen increased military raids and violations by Israeli forces in recent months
